    As a biochemist, i add the following info to clarify what was said in the video: Betaine anhydrous and betaine monohydrate are equivalent in terms of its biochemical properties. Anhydrous just means the powder crystals do not contain water. Monohydrate contains 1:1 ratio of water molecules to betaine molecules. Betaine HCl is technically anhydrous because its powder crystals do not contain water. Betaine HCl is just the acidic form of betaine. You can convert betaine HCl to betaine by adding a solution of sodium bicarbonate until the mixture is pH 7.2 (neutral). The hydrochloric acid (HCl) in your stomach will convert 1/2 your betaine to betaine HCl. To get the same dosage, you'll need to adjust for the differences in molecular weight. That means you'll need to take 1.15 g of betaine monohydrate to equal 1 g of betaine anhydrous.
